Handover — fd leak hunt, Varnet ingest service. Leak shows after ~6h under load; lsof count climbs steadily. Suspect the retry path in the Quillfeed client not closing sockets. Repro script is in the tools dir. Rolo has context if stuck. The service currently runs with these settings.

service settings:
[casax]
port = 6379
team = rusir
host = casax.zemvarhq.corp
region = outer-4
access_code = ac_9808ce
timeout_ms = 1500

- [ ] Review websocket compression settings before the Ferndale key ceremony proceeds. New team members should know we disable per-message deflate on the Quillmark ceremony channel: the CPU savings aren't worth latency spikes when custodians confirm shares in real time. Compression stays on for the audit mirror, where throughput matters more than jitter. Confirm both settings match the ceremony config sheet, then have the lead custodian read out the recovery passphrase recorded below.

vault phrase of kawep-tahog = ulaix-briath

// MAX_FANOUT_BATCH caps how many regional alert queues the Stormline
// dispatcher writes to per tick. Support: if customers in the Vellmark
// region report delayed severe-weather pushes, this is the first knob
// to check. Raising it above 48 has caused broker backpressure before;
// do not touch without paging the on-call. Lowering it only delays
// fan-out, it never drops alerts. When filing an escalation, include
// the token printed on the line below.

pipeline stamp: htk9_82d907462

## Data stores — Fernhopper shipping-fee rules engine

Heads up for reviewers: the rules engine keeps rule definitions in a small relational store and compiled rule sets in a cache layer. Writes go through the admin API only — please flag any direct table writes in review. Migrations live under /migrations and run on deploy. For local testing, the rules store is reachable with the following connection string.

replica DSN, tawef-hahap: mysql://eliix_svc:FiIC0jz@db-394a.lumiclabs.internal:5432/holius